Description


Reporting directly to the Resident Services Director (RSD) or Qualified Intellectual Disabilities Professional (QIDP), the Direct Support Professional (DSP) is responsible for participating as a member of the facility team to ensure safe and effective residential facilities. The DSP provides direct support, positive direction and assistance to the CILA (Community Integrated Living Arrangement) and/or ICF (Intermediate Care Facility) residents in accordance with program policies and procedures, assisting individuals to be as independent as possible. The DSP at Progressive Housing, Inc. is adaptable, mission oriented, goal driven, highly organized, efficient, a positive role model, and exercises good judgment and decision making skills.

Responsibilities:
  • Be familiar and comply with current state and federal rules and regulations and perform all assigned tasks in accordance with facility policy and procedures
  • Ensure that individuals exercise their rights and are treated with dignity and respect
  • Respect and maintain confidentiality of all individuals' personal information
  • Responsible for the implementation and documentation of individual goals and objectives
  • Be familiar with emergency behavior management techniques as set forth by Crisis Prevention Institute (CPI), standard precautions and infection control techniques, the proper placement and use of emergency equipment and procedures, and good body mechanics to maintain a clean, safe, positive and secure environment at all times.
  • Assist individuals with their activities of daily living (ADL) while promoting independence which may include, but not limited to, household chores, recreational activities, physical fitness activities, grooming and dressing, and money management
  • Know the whereabouts of individuals you are directly responsible for at all times
  • Attend Individual Service Plans (ISPs) meetings and assist in the development of the program plan while working closely with each individual to identify supports that will improve the quality of life and ensuring positive outcomes
  • Attend in-service training as required to continue skill development and complete paperwork, as necessary, to meet PHI, federal, and state regulatory requirements
  • Assist in the orientation and training of new employees
  • Assist with general housekeeping (cleaning, laundry, vacuuming, dusting, mopping, sanitizing, etc.) while promoting involvement of the individual
  • Prepare meals, with the assistance of individuals, according to standardized recipes and the designated menu
  • Prepare and assist individuals on outings, shopping trips, vacations, home visits and appointments by providing transportation, guidance, and support where needed with guardian approval
  • Observe for and report medical concerns and accidents / incidents immediately to the RSD/QIDP and Nurse
  • Administer medications and take and record vitals while utilizing nurse protocols as directed
  • Report any and all allegations of individual abuse or neglect that is reported to or witnessed to the RSD/QIDP and Office of Inspector General (OIG)
  • Other miscellaneous duties as assigned

Position Requirements

  • High School Diploma or equivalent
  • Age 18 or older
  • Ability to read and comprehend English at an 8th grade level based on standardized testing
  • Must be a certified DSP, certified in CPR/First Aid and certified for Medication Administration or enroll in the company provided courses, achieve passing scores and become certified
  • Valid Illinois driver's license and comply with company policy for driving company vehicles
  • Ability to pass a criminal background check and drug screen
  • Able to lift at least 50lbs, daily standing, bending, lifting
  • No experience necessary, but prior experience working with individuals with developmental disabilities preferred
